KUALA LUMPUR: Bursa Malaysia continued to lift for a fifth straight session despite a prevailing sense of caution over corporate earnings and the global economy.
Reuters reported that Japan's exports fell almost 12% in March from a year earlier, with shipments to the US down over 16%.
